The PEN/ESPN Lifetime Achievement Award for Literary Sports Writing is given to one living American or U.S.-based writer each year to celebrate their body of work. The award seeks to recognize a lifetime of writing about sports and its dimensions of character and action with keen knowledge and insight, and especially with a literary voice evidenced in a style of agility and flair. Eligible candidates may work in short- or long-form prose.  Winners receive a prize of $5,000 and are selected at the discretion of a panel of three judges, selected by the PEN Awards Committee, who make their decision based on their knowledge of sports writing, as well as letters of nomination from PEN Members. Judges will also be permitted to supplement the list of candidates with nominations of their own.
